第三章C语言程序设计基础.ppt
《第三章C语言程序设计基础.ppt》由会员分享,可在线阅读,更多相关《第三章C语言程序设计基础.ppt(27页珍藏版)》请在三一办公上搜索。
1、C/C+程序设计,主要内容,常量和变量 基本数据类型运算符和表达式常用数学函数,1、常量和变量,常量:在程序运行中,其值保持不变符号常量文字常量变量:在程序运行中,值发生变化;必须先定义,再使用;变量通过变量名来标识。变量名和内存中的存储单元相对应。编写程序时通过变量名来存、取存储单元。,2、数据类型,数据类型,构造类型,指针类型,空类型(无值类型)void,简单数据类型,一.整型数据整数 整型数据包括整型常量和整型变量,整型数据以二进制补码形式存储。1.整型常量三种表示形式:十进制整数:由数字09和正负号表示.如:123,-456,0八进制整数:由数字0开头,后跟数字07表示.如:0123,
2、011十六进制整数:由0 x或0X开头,后跟09,af,AF表示.如0 x123,0Xff,简单数据类型,定义整数的符号常量#define NUM1 20/十进制数20#define NUM2 020/八进制数(十进制16)#define NUM3 0 x2a/十六进制数(十进制42),思考题:下列整型常量哪些是非法的?012,oX7A,00,078,0 x5Ac,-0 xFFFF,0034,7B。,首字符不能是字母o,八进制数中不能有数字8,十进制数中不能有字母B,简单数据类型,2.整型变量整型变量的定义:int x,y,z;说明:整型类型名:int必须小写int与变量名之间至少要用一个空格
3、隔开int后面一次可以定义多个变量,但是变量名之间要以“,”隔开可以在变量定义时就赋初值最后必须以“;”结束,int a;int x,y,z;int m=2,n=-3;,简单数据类型,二.实型数据浮点数(小数)1、实型常量两种表示形式:小数:由数字09和小数点组成指数:其一般形式为:aEn 值为:a*10n,注意:所有的实型常量按照double类型处理。,例:以下哪些实型常量的表示方法不合法?1.2 345 3e4.5 2.3E4 e5 34e-5 2E,三.字符型数据 字符型数据是用来表征英文字母、符号、汉字的数据。占用1个字节的内存单元,用于存放字符所对应的ASCII码。1、字符型常量两种
4、表示方法:用单引号括起来的一个字符 如 a A?使用转义字符 用于表示一些无法直接输入的字符 如 n,简单数据类型,简单数据类型,转义字符及其含义:,简单数据类型,2、字符型变量 数据类型符是char,在内存中占1个字节(8位)一个字符变量只能包含一个字符 字符型数据在内存中以相应的ASCII值存储 char a=a;,a ASCII值为97内存中存储形式,0 1 1 0 0 0 0 1,简单数据类型,在ASCII范围以内,整型数据与字符型数据可以通用,#include void main()char c;c=c;printf(%cn,c);printf(%dn,c);,简单数据类型,3.字符
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 第三 语言程序设计 基础

链接地址:https://www.31ppt.com/p-5940709.html